Downspout rerouting services involve adjusting the path of a property's existing downspouts to better direct rainwater away from the foundation and landscaping. This process typically includes disconnecting the current downspouts from their original outlets and installing new piping or extensions that channel water to more appropriate drainage areas. The goal is to prevent water from pooling near the home’s foundation, which can cause structural issues or basement flooding. These services are often performed with attention to the property's specific layout, ensuring that rainwater is diverted efficiently and safely away from critical areas.
Many common problems can be addressed through downspout rerouting. For homes experiencing water pooling around the foundation, rerouting can help reduce the risk of basement leaks or foundation damage. It can also prevent erosion of landscaping, protect walkways from becoming slippery or damaged, and minimize the likelihood of mold or moisture-related issues inside the home. Property owners who notice water pouring directly onto driveways or sidewalks during heavy rains may find that rerouting the downspouts helps manage runoff more effectively, maintaining both the home’s integrity and safety.

The overview below groups typical Downspout Rerouting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Herndon,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or rerouting jobs for existing downspouts typ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, especially when addressing localized issues or simple reroutes.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range but are less common.
Partial Downspout Rerouting - When rerouting a section of downspouts to improve drainage,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,200. This range covers most standard projects in Herndon, VA, with fewer jobs reaching into higher tiers.
Full Downspout System Replacement - Replacing entire downspout systems generally costs between $1,500 and $3,500. Larger or more intricate installations can go beyond this, especially if additional gutter work or structural modifications are needed.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ly detailed rerouting or custom drainage solutions can range from $3,500 to $5,000 or more. These proj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ive work or challenging site conditions requiring specialized services.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is downspout rerouting? Downspout rerouting involves redirecting the flow of rainwater from existing downspouts to prevent water from pooling near a building’s foundation or causing erosion issues.
Why might someone need downspout rerouting services? Homeowners may consider rerouting downspouts to improve drainage, protect landscaping, or address water damage concerns around their property.
How do local contractors handle downspout rerouting projects? Local service providers assess the property, determine the best rerouting path, and install new piping or extensions to effectively manage rainwater runoff.
Are there different methods for rerouting downspouts? Yes, options include extending downspouts with pipes, installing underground drainage systems, or redirecting water to specific landscaping areas.
What should be considered before rerouting downspouts? Factors like property layout, drainage slope, and local building codes can influence the best approach for rerouting downspouts effectively.
